Driver, Carrier and Vehicle Services is the province's licensing body and the foundational entry point for individuals, drivers, carriers, and vehicle programs. Our client-centric approach supports the safe and efficient movement of people and goods across Alberta, and we're looking for a Licensing Officer to help us deliver on that mission.

As a Licensing Officer in the Examinations, Licensing and Support Section, you will ensure that Driver Training Schools, Driving Instructors, and Driver Examiners are properly licensed and meet all regulatory requirements. From evaluating applications and issuing licences to supporting system improvements and advising stakeholders, your work will directly influence the integrity and safety of Alberta's driver education framework.

Your key responsibilities include:

  • Assessing and issuing licences for driver training schools, instructors, and examiners in accordance with legislation.
  • Providing expert guidance to stakeholders, including contractors, registry agents, and the public.
  • Developing and maintaining program documentation, forms, and reports.
  • Managing licensing data and ensuring integrity within systems like TSIS and MOVES.
  • Supporting policy and system improvements, including user testing and cross-departmental coordination.
  • Processing and reconciling licensing fees and financial transactions.
